What is Love

Love.

Millions of people say “I love you” everyday. Love is more that a four letter word, it has meaning. So, what is love then? Love can be defined as a strong liking for someone or something. Love is affectionate feelings for different people including husband, wife, and children. However, the love for each of these is completely different. Various types of love exist. Love is an intense feeling of affection, an emotion and even affects the way a person acts. Yet, without love what would life be like?

Love has many definitions, which varies from one person to another. One may never know what true love is until it has been experienced. Love is the most amazing, affectionate feeling that can be experienced.

There are different types of love that exist. Love is usually strong between a husband and a wife but the type of love is different than love for a child. Love can occur between two or more individuals. The love for a husband and wife is one that bonds them and connects them in a unified link of trust, intimacy and interdependence. It enhances the relationship and comforts the soul. Love should be experienced and not just felt. The depth of love can not be measured. The relationship between a father, a mother and a child is a different type of bond. The mother loves the child unconditionally and it can not be measured at all, same as the husband and wife. Love between parent and children forms the basis for any childhood. It is not limited to the likes of childhood but decides the emotional quotient of an individual. The quality of the relationship is affected by the parent’s marriage, age, and experience.

Love is how you make another person feel when you are in their presence. Love is the laughter that you share, the time you spend, and the relationship that you build with that special someone. Love is missing someone even when they are right next to you. Many people show or express their love for someone in many and different ways.

Love also has its negative effects. Love can hurt and can cause broken hearts. There is deception, blindness, and vulnerability. It takes effort to work at a relationship. Love can cause agreements. Love can be one-sided and miserable. The percentage rate of suicide due to love being rejected is extremely high. This is part of reality and it has been accepted by some of society, yet there are some people that still believe love is a fairy tale.
